GOOTU dual output hybrid solar inverter is a type of solar inverter that has two separate AC outputs. This allows for the inverter to be used in a variety of different applications, such as powering two separate buildings or powering a home and a backup generator simultaneously. The dual output feature also allows for greater flexibility in system design, as it can be used to optimize energy production and distribution. Dual output solar inverters are commonly used in larger residential and commercial solar installations.

4 charging modes
1.Solar First: Use solar energy to charge the battery first, and only use the mains when there is no solar energy.
2.Utility First: Use the mains to charge the battery first, and only use solar energy when there is no mains.
3.Solar and Utility: Both solar energy and mains charge the battery at the same time.
4.Only Solar: Only rely on solar energy to charge, and will not use mains even if there is mains.
